http://insilico.ehu.es/digest/index.php?mo=Mycobacterium WebTth111II is a thermostable Type IIGS restriction enzyme that recognizes DNA sites CAARCA (R 5 A or G) and cleaves downstream at N11/N9. Here, the tth111IIRM gene was cloned and expressed in E. coli, and Tth111II was purified. The purified enzyme contains internally-bound S-adenosylmethionine (SAM).

Include Type IIb restriction enzymes (Two cleaves per recognition … WebMar 10, 2024 · The best candidate for this role is the endonuclease Tth111II , whose deletion produced a 1,000-fold decrease in transjugation efficiency. This type IIG restriction enzyme has a rather low specific activity and preferentially nicks the top strand at position N11 downstream from its CAARCA recognition sequence.

WebThe present invention relates to recombinant DNA which encodes the Tth111II restriction endonuclease-methylase fusion protein (Tth111IIRM), expression of Tth111II restriction endonuclease-methylase fusion protein in E. coli cells containing the recombinant DNA, and purification of Tth111II endonuclease-methylase fusion protein to near homogeneity.
